| 英文摘要 | Catastrophic multi-phase mass flows (CMMFs) constitute significant geohazards in high mountain cryosphere area, particularly in Southeastern Tibet Plateau (SETP) where temperate glaciers retreat rapidly. Research on the CMMFs is still limited for a systematic understanding of relationships between their magnitude-frequency and susceptibility. In this study, we re-evaluated eight temperate glacial catchments affected by recurrent CMMFs using multi-source geophysical data to quantitatively evaluate their hypsometry, glacier characteristics, and instability. The fuzzy analytic hierarchy process (FAHP) framework was employed to evaluate the CMMFs susceptibility. We showed that these CMMF events typically transpire during summer monsoon seasons, while ice avalanches can occur during cold seasons, glacier debris flows showing significantly elevated susceptibility. This study provides an analysis strategy for hazard assessment and risk adaptation of CMMFs. |
